Isaac Ullah Member since: Mon, Mar 27, 2017 at 05:09 PM Full Member Reviewer

PhD, Anthropology, Arizona State University, MA, Anthropology, University of Toronto, BSc, Anthropology, University of California, Davis

I am a computational archaeologist and Professor of Anthropology at San Diego State University, where I direct the Computational Archaeology Laboratory. My research integrates geospatial analysis, agent-based and simulation modeling, and complex adaptive systems theory to investigate long-term human–environment interactions, with particular attention to socio-environmental change associated with early farming and herding in Mediterranean and other semi-arid landscapes. I have conducted field and modeling research in regions including Italy, Jordan, and Central Asia, and my work spans landscape archaeology, land-use dynamics, and environmental modeling. I have been a member of the CoMSES community for well over a decade and have contributed multiple models to the Computational Model Library, several of which have undergone formal peer review. In addition to research, I regularly teach with agent-based models at undergraduate and graduate levels and use CoMSES models as both research and pedagogical resources. I am committed to open, reproducible, and theoretically informed computational modeling and to strengthening the role of peer-reviewed models as durable scholarly contributions.

Davide Secchi Member since: Tue, Jul 08, 2014 at 10:58 PM Full Member

PhD in Business Administration

I am Professor of Management at Paris School of Business and have held positions at the University of Southern Denmark, Bournemouth University (UK), University of Wisconsin (US), and at the University of Insubria (Italy). My current research efforts are on socially-based decision making, agent-based modeling, cognitive processes in organizations and socially responsible behavior in organizations. With a coauthor network of 50 colleagues located in over 10 different countries, I have published 126 (as of 2025) among articles, book chapters, and books. The monograph Computational organizational cognition (2021, Emerald), and the edited Agent-Based Simulation of Organizational Behavior with M. Neumann (2016, Springer Nature) specifically target computational simulation research in the social sciences. The book How do I Develop an Agent-Based Model? (2022, Elgar) is the first specifically written for business and management scholars.

My simulation research focuses on the applications of ABM to organizational behavior studies. I study socially-distributed decision making—i.e., the process of exploiting external resources in a social environment—and I work to develop its theoretical underpinnings in order to to test it. A second stream of research is on how group dynamics affect individual perceptions of social responsibility and on the definition and measurement of individual social responsibility (I-SR).
